Cities XXL

Description
Cities XXL is a single-player city-building simulation game. The player assumes the role of a city planner who oversees the growth of urban settlements across a variety of landscapes. Beginning with an undeveloped plot of land, the objective is to construct a functioning city, manage resources, and balance the needs of the population while expanding into a sprawling metropolis.
Core gameplay focuses on zoning land for different purposes: residential, commercial, industrial, and office districts. Each zone attracts citizens or businesses depending on their income levels and requirements. The player must provide supporting infrastructure such as roads, power plants, and water systems to maintain growth. Traffic management is central, as inefficient road layouts or congestion can reduce productivity and lower resident satisfaction.
The simulation tracks citizen behavior, economic demand, and environmental factors in real time. Players need to provide jobs for various social classes, from unskilled workers to executives, while keeping pollution and noise under control. Balancing taxes, wages, and services creates an economy that can thrive or falter depending on the player’s management.
Beyond the core zoning and infrastructure, the game includes specialized systems for mass transit, utilities, and leisure. Public services such as police, fire stations, schools, and hospitals must be placed strategically to cover the expanding population. Recreational areas, sports facilities, and cultural buildings raise quality of life, while large projects like stadiums and airports help transform a town into a global city.
The game features over 1,000 building types and more than 65 map locations, each with unique terrain and resource conditions. Players can build in deserts, valleys, or coastal areas, and adapt to challenges like limited flat land or access to trade routes. Cities can also be linked together in a wider network, allowing resources to be imported and exported between settlements. Support for user-created content and modding is included, letting players customize assets and add new features.
